Labour ComplianceThe Department of Labour Welfare, Assam, on February 12, 2026, issued a notification regarding revised VDA for Multiple Scheduled Employments.

The following has been stated: -

•In continuation of Notification No. E238621/696 dated June 14, 2025, the Government of Assam has revised the Variable Dearness Allowance (VDA) based on a 100% rise in the All India CPI (IW) (Base 2016=100).

•The average CPI for December 2024–May 2025 increased by 0.8 points (0.14%) over June–November 2024, leading to revised VDA rates across numerous scheduled employments.

•Revised total monthly wages now range from Rs. 10,354 for unskilled workers to Rs. 19,345 for highly skilled workers.

•The updated VDA rates are effective from June 01, 2025, and apply to workers across diverse sectors, including manufacturing, agriculture, transport, shops, and other notified establishments.
